26445210521 has 2 divisors, whose sum is σ = 26445210522. Its totient is φ = 26445210520.

The previous prime is 26445210511. The next prime is 26445210587. The reversal of 26445210521 is 12501254462.

It is a weak prime.

It can be written as a sum of positive squares in only one way, i.e., 26425753600 + 19456921 = 162560^2 + 4411^2 .

It is a cyclic number.

It is not a de Polignac number, because 26445210521 - 218 = 26444948377 is a prime.

It is not a weakly prime, because it can be changed into another prime (26445210511) by changing a digit.

It is a polite number, since it can be written as a sum of consecutive naturals, namely, 13222605260 + 13222605261.

It is an arithmetic number, because the mean of its divisors is an integer number (13222605261).
